You can simply assign to Cursor.Position. However, in a console application you will need to add references to the WinForms assemblies because console application projects do not include references to WinForms by default. You will need to add System.Windows.Forms and System.Drawing, the latter to gain access to the Point class. crown template for kids to wear

Nettet30. okt. 2012 · One of the most common tasks on a dual-monitor setup is moving windows from one screen to another. Traditionally this involves dragging the title bar across screens via the mouse. Nettet25. okt. 2024 · Hit Windows+P and select "Extend" from the display options, then drag and drop your Window from one monitor to another monitor using your cursor. You can also press Windows+Shift+Left Arrow to move a window left, or Windows+Shift+Right Arrow to move a window right.
